"no password configured for VNC auth"


I have set up my VNC server at an linux machine and all the clients are windows users.

When the clients connect to the linux vnc server is says "no password configured for VNC auth". I just canīt get it to work.. please help me.

You didn't offer much detail on your install, but perhaps
Code:
 vncpasswd
is what you need.
